I have a fibreglass shower base (white) that has dark stains that resist exit mould and everyday shower cleaners. What would you recommend please.

Ive had good results on some really bad fiberglass shower floors using The Works T-bowl cleaner and a scrub brush. Squirt some on the floor add water and scrub with a long handled kitchen brush. Then rinse good.
Make sure you test a spot. Ive never had a problem but you never know. Also don't leave it on too long before you rinse. And be sure to vent. The fumes will get you. PHEW.
Sometimes the floor finish is so worn that the undercoat is showing. In that case forget it.
Home Depot has recoating kit for fiberglass showers and tubs. Ive never tried it but you might want to check it out. Good luck, Tom

I have used a thick layer of borax or ZUD on a damp surface. You may get most of the stain out but it will likely stain again if the surface is etched or shot. Tom is talking about something like Rust=-o-leums Tub and Tile kit. Works great but the fumes will knock you off your feet.
